011 Xueshan North Peak
Elevation
3703m
Trig point
Third-Order
Listing
Gentle Ten #2
Location
Tai'an Township, Miaoli County/Heping District, Taichung City
Xueshan North Peak is located on the northern ridge of the Xueshan Range within Shei-Pa National Park, forming an important summit along the northern approach to Xueshan Main Peak. The mountain is composed mainly of sandstone, slate, and metamorphic rocks, with its landscape shaped by tectonic uplift, weathering, and erosion over geological time. Its terrain features broad ridgelines, alpine slopes, and high-elevation grasslands, creating a distinctive mountain environment. The surrounding area preserves valuable alpine ecosystems, including Taiwan fir forests, alpine shrubs, and dwarf bamboo grasslands that support a variety of endemic mountain flora. Due to its elevated position and expansive views, Xueshan North Peak offers exceptional panoramas of Xueshan Main Peak, Mt. Dabajian, the Holy Ridge, and the northern Central Mountain Range, making it one of Taiwan’s notable locations for alpine landscape photography and ecological observation.
